Delete Me 5 features
Zerocoder 0 features
  • Privacy Protection
    DeleteMe helps users remove their personal information from data brokers, enhancing their privacy and reducing the risk of identity theft.
  • Ease of Use
    The platform provides a straightforward process for users to submit their removal requests, making it accessible even for those not tech-savvy.
  • Regular Reports
    DeleteMe provides regular reports that show users the status of their data removal, helping them track what information has been removed.
  • Comprehensive Coverage
    The service targets a wide range of data brokers, offering comprehensive protection as it deals with multiple sites that collect and sell user data.
  • Customer Support
    DeleteMe offers customer support to assist users with any questions or issues, providing reassurance and help when needed.

Possible disadvantages

  • Subscription Cost
    The service requires a subscription, which may be expensive for some customers who need to remove their data from multiple brokers.
  • Limited International Reach
    DeleteMe primarily operates in the United States, potentially limiting its effectiveness for users based in other countries.
  • Not Instantaneous
    While the service does work to remove information, the process can take time, sometimes weeks, to see full results across all sites.
  • No Guarantee of Complete Removal
    DeleteMe cannot guarantee the complete removal of information from all brokers, as some may have hidden caches or re-list data later.
  • Periodic Renewals Required
    Users will need to continually renew their subscriptions to ensure ongoing protection and removal of their data.
